The Network Administrator will be a key member of the eBags Systems 
and Network Administration team. You will have the opportunity to 
work with industry leading Network and Internet Infrastructure at one 
of the World's top E-Commerce companies – right here in the beautiful 
Denver, Colorado area!  
Qualified applicants will have extensive experience administering a 
scalable network infrastructure in a high-availability and high-
transaction environment that is expanding globally.  Some experience 
with network configuration and design, and a solid understanding of 
internetworking concepts is required.  We are a fast growing company 
with a commitment to doing things right the first time so a positive, 
tenacious, and cooperative attitude - and the ability and desire to 
function as part of a team - are extremely important.
Responsibilities:
• 5-7+ years experience implementing and maintaining WAN and LAN 
infrastructure in a fast-growing, 24/7/365 Internet facing production 
environment. 
• Experience with industry best practices for network administration, 
service delivery and support, security management, and capacity 
monitoring and planning. 
• Experience and strong proficiency with the system functionality and 
syntax of one or more of the following manufacturer products; Cisco, 
HP, Juniper, and Foundry.  Preference for HP and Cisco switches and 
routers, Juniper/ScreenOS firewalls, and Foundry and Cisco Load 
Balancers.
• Experience supporting fault-tolerant, self-healing networks. 
• Experience with network and service monitoring applications
• Technical leadership and mentoring experience. 
• Strong grasp of network security fundamentals. 
• Solid understanding of the OSI seven layer model and TCP/IP 
networking. 
• Datacenter operations and best practices (cabling, racking, 
organizing). 
• Experience with Windows 2003/2000 and Active Directory System 
Administration.
• Ability to work autonomously with key third party partners and 
providers on network projects.
• Must be organized and have a commitment to the discipline of 
documentation and daily monitoring controls.
• Must be able to work after hours and on weekends as scheduled 
maintenance windows and emergency issues require.
• Must be eligible to work in the United States; visa applications 
will not be sponsored.
